Microsoft Teams is a team collaboration application developed by Microsoft as part of the Microsoft 365 family of products, offering workspace chat and video conferencing, file storage, and integration of proprietary and third-party applications and services.

Satin is considered to be Silk's successor, and was initially announced and implemented for Microsoft Teams in 2020. As of February 2021, it was used for all two-way calls in both Teams and Skype. [2] According to Microsoft, a future release will add support for music in full-band stereo at bitrates of at least 17 kbps. [2]
Microsoft 365 is a product family of productivity software, collaboration and cloud-based services owned by Microsoft.
